The MCFD Max is a Max that did not appear in the cartoon, but was mentioned in Nixel, Nixel, Go Away.
Physical Appearance
Overall, this max resembles Hydro the most.
He is a giant overweight red Max that retains most of the elements and abilities from Hydro. He has Hydro's ladder which is reduced to a tail with three red sprayer hoses, supported by a red and yellow bucket. He also has Hydro's wheels on his feet covered by two wheel arches; two extra ones on the top of his hands with red and black palms, and two yellow fingers on each side with blue sirens on his fingertips. He has a safety valve from one of Aquad's water buckets and Splasho's hydrant spout at the back. His head features a grill and a sky-blue glass window on top (which further represents him as a firetruck) and four nostrils with an triangle nose at the front of his face. He has an overbite mouth with four sets of teeth on the top and bottom, two blue and yellow sirens on his jaw, and a grey and white bumper on his rounded belly. He also has Splasho's toes with two sirens on his feet.
Biography
The Max was intended to save a Mixie Cat that was trapped in a burning building as requested by the Fire Chief, but the MCFD refused. ("Nixel, Nixel, Go Away")
Set Information

The MCFD Max can be built using parts combined from Mixels sets 41563 Splasho, 41564 Aquad, and 41565 Hydro. Extra parts are left over after construction. Instructions are available on the LEGO website downloads page.
Trivia
- He is the thickest Max.
- Just like Hydro, he resembles a fire truck. His LEGO instructions also show that he can transform into what looks like a fire truck.
- He bares a large resemblance to the 2014 Infernites Max, despite their elements being the opposite of each other.
- His head somewhat resembles a beaver.
- At Nuremburg Toy Fair, his feet were posed backwards, the wing pieces his eyes connect to were upside down, and the ladder on his back was absent.
- However, this is because the ladder pieces were accidentally used on the Medix Max.
